4. I'm not so sure I agree with Jonathan Alter's comparison.
I know he wrote a book about FDR, but it seems to me he was picking and choosing his comparison points.

I also don't agree with Alter's statement that all social legislation starts out ill defined, covering few people and then, over time, improves. I keep thinking of how the repukes and bushes bombed medicare with that awful part D, how Clinton devastated welfare, and how through manipulating the consumer price index, they have reduced the average payment to social security beneficiaries, so that current payouts are equal to about 1970 levels , some say 1950 levels.

7. Your objections prove his point.
Unfortunately for anyone who cares about the planet or his or her fellow human beings, the right wing was able to "disimprove" those programs. They used precisely the mechanism Alter is referring to, but in their own evil direction. They weren't able to abolish them, just severely weaken them, that's the "social contract" part.

Social legislation is improvable over time is his point, I think, once its existence is no longer in doubt. You picked and chose your examples to show that it's also possible to weaken it over time. What I don't understand in discussions here is the implication that social legislation never improves over time, something that the critics see as self-evident. They never make a good tight case for their point of view, because they can't.
